If http://lotusmoons.wordpress.com/ is the blog you are talking about, you have only one post, and it has no category assigned to it. Categories will not appear in the category widget until there is a post assigned to it.
You assign categories to posts when you write them. At the top of the column to the right of the test area is a blue bar with “categories” in it. When you write a post, you check the categories you want to assign to that post there. The categories assigned will then show up in the category widget.

I’ve since read that the categories widget will not actually allow you to separate your posts, but will simply duplicate the same list of posts to each ‘category’. Is this infact true?
We can have multiple categories widgets in our sidebars if we choose. Every individual categories widget we use will show all the categories* that we configure them to show.
We can make these selections inside every individual categories widget
Title:
Show as dropdown
Show post counts
Show hierarchy -
